How much rent can you afford?

The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.

Frequently Asked Questions about Cypress Glen Apartments with Swimming Pool

What is the Cheapest Swimming Pool apartment in Cypress Glen?

Currently the most affordable Apartment in Cypress Glen with Swimming Pool is at Mission Lakes listed at $1,700.

How much is the average rent for Cypress Glen Apartments with Swimming Pool?

The average rent for a Apartment in Cypress Glen with Swimming Pool is $2,535.

What is the largest Cypress Glen Apartment for rent with Swimming Pool?

Today's Apartment with Swimming Pool and the most square footage in Cypress Glen is a 1,970 square feet unit starting from $1,850 at Palms Point.

What is the average size for Cypress Glen Apartments for rent with Swimming Pool?

The average size for a rental with Swimming Pool in Cypress Glen is currently at 897 sq ft.
